How Hospitality CRM Supports Guest Lifecycle Management

A complete guest lifecycle includes pre-arrival, stay, and post-stay engagement. CRM solutions support every stage:

  • Pre-arrival: Automated welcome messages, targeted promotions, and reservation reminders.

  • During stay: Personalized service requests, in-stay communication, and upsell suggestions.

  • Post-stay: Review requests, loyalty updates, and targeted remarketing.

This leads to enhanced guest satisfaction and stronger retention.

Essential Features to Look for in Hospitality CRM Solutions

Integrated Guest Profiles & Preference Tracking

A good CRM consolidates guest information from multiple sources—PMS, POS, booking engines, and online travel platforms. This creates a unified guest view essential for personalization.

Automated Marketing & Upselling Tools

Email campaigns, promotional offers, seasonal packages, and upsell notifications can be automated based on guest behavior and preferences. This boosts revenue and reduces manual workload.

Channel Management & Communication Features

Multi-channel messaging (email, SMS, WhatsApp, social media) ensures hotels stay connected with guests at every stage of their journey.

Real-Time Analytics & Performance Reporting

CRM platforms offer dashboards to track KPIs such as guest satisfaction, booking trends, revenue performance, and team productivity. Managers can make data-driven decisions that improve operations.


Leading Hotel CRM Brands to Explore

Below are some of the top CRM providers trusted in the hospitality industry. These brands are well-established, feature-rich, and used by hotels worldwide.

Salesforce Hospitality Cloud

This platform delivers advanced automation, AI-powered insights, and extensive customization. Salesforce integrates seamlessly with hotel management systems and provides powerful marketing tools.

Oracle Hospitality OPERA Cloud CRM

Oracle’s OPERA suite is widely used in large hotels and global chains. It offers robust features for reservations, guest management, and analytics. It’s known for its enterprise-grade reliability.

Zoho CRM for Hotels & Resorts

Zoho is an affordable and flexible option suitable for small to medium-sized hospitality businesses. It offers mobile apps, omnichannel support, and customizable workflows.

HubSpot CRM for Hospitality Teams

HubSpot is user-friendly and ideal for hotels focused on marketing automation, customer support, and lead management. Its free version is especially appealing for smaller teams.
